How they compare
Brazil currently reports 65.9% against 64.9% in Portugal, a difference of 1.0%.
Across all 24 years both countries report, Brazil has been ahead every year.
Brazil ranks 81st and Portugal ranks 82nd of 132 countries.
Brazil has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Brazil | Portugal |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 12.8% | 11.6% | 1.2% | Brazil |
| 2000s | 43.1% | 33.8% | 9.3% | Brazil |
| 2010s | 55.4% | 51.4% | 4.0% | Brazil |
| 2020s | 64.9% | 61.7% | 3.2% | Brazil |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
